Lake Mergozzo

Highlight • Lake

Mergozzo is an Italian town of 2 141 inhabitants in the province of Verbano-Cusio-Ossola in Piedmont, overlooking the lake of the same name. It is considered the southern gate of the Ossola Valley of which the independent Republic of the same name represented the southern border together with the nearby municipality of Ornavasso.

Feriolo Lakeside Promenade

Highlight • Viewpoint

Feriolo is at home in the central part of Lake Maggiore in the Toce estuary. Just three kilometers north of Baveno, the small village gracefully stretches along the shores of Lake Maggiore. The Borromean Bay seems to be within easy reach. In the background the mountains of Ossola rise over wide valleys. The towns that catch the eye to the left and right of Feriolo are Verbania and Baveno.

Orta San Giulio - Lake Orta Orta San Giulio - Lake Orta - Faith, nature, history and beauty - Lake Orta, with its 13.4 km long and 2.5 km wide, is a real jewel between the green of the Alps and vast hill forests. The silent little cousin of the majestic Lake Maggiore. The shores of the lake are dotted with small picturesque villages, ancient villages and marinas that tell the story of the life of the fishermen who were once the most numerous inhabitants of Lake Orta. Today, however, they are the accumulation of modern stories of pleasure boats and ports, of international quality tourism. Orta is an ideal destination for families, couples looking for a romantic place to relax, sports lovers and for young and old who love nature and its energy. Alberto
November 10, 2022, Lago di Mergozzo

The lake is suitable for swimming and its pure waters are a favorite destination for water sports enthusiasts such as canoeing, kayaking, windsurfing. Originally it was part of Lake Maggiore which was higher and more extensive than the current one. In remote centuries the continuous floods of the Toce river created a delta dam, the current plain of Fondotoce, which divides the two lakes. Lake Mergozzo is connected to the Maggiore by a 2.7 km canal, not navigable due to the difference in height, along which a splendid cycle path runs.

What kind of local craftsmanship or industries can be found in Quarna Sopra?

Quarna Sopra has a rich tradition in wood-turning, which is still maintained as a cottage industry. This reflects the village's cultural heritage and offers a glimpse into local craftsmanship. Additionally, the nearby Quarna Sotto is renowned for its long-established tradition of making wind instruments.
